Daily Itinerary

Day1

Day 1
Day 1: Arrival in Palermo

  • Museo Palazzo Mirto Casa Museo
  • Caletta Sant'Elia
  • More

Upon landing at Palermo Airport, collect your rental car and make your way to your hotel in the vibrant city of Palermo. After settling in, embark on an afternoon stroll through the historic city center. Discover the exquisite Capella Palatina, a masterpiece of Norman architecture adorned with intricate mosaics. Continue to the Palermo Cathedral, a stunning blend of architectural styles, and conclude your exploration at the La Martorana Church, renowned for its dazzling mosaics. Enjoy a restful night in Palermo.

Day2

Day 2
Day 2: Explore Taormina

  • Taormina
  • More
  • Greek - Roman theatre
  • Roman Odeon
  • Basilica of St. Nicholas of Bari
  • More

After a delightful breakfast, drive to your accommodation in the charming town of Taormina. Spend the day exploring its captivating highlights, including the ancient Greek Theatre and the Roman Odeon. Take in the panoramic views from Piazza IX Aprile and admire the Duomo's beauty as you wander through the quaint streets. End your day with a taste of the local granita with brioche at one of the town's beloved bars. Overnight in Taormina.

Day3

Day 3
Day 3: Discover Mount Etna

  • Taormina
  • More
  • Piano Provenzana
  • Alcantara River Park
  • More

Begin your day with a hearty breakfast before embarking on a self-guided adventure to Mount Etna. Drive to Rifugio Sapienza or Piano Provenzana and follow the marked trails up the mountainside. Marvel at the dramatic landscapes shaped by volcanic activity and visit the Etna Park Visitor Center for a deeper understanding of the region's geology. After your exploration, enjoy a wine tasting at a local winery on the slopes of Mount Etna. Return to Taormina for an overnight stay.

Day4

Day 4
Day 4: Explore Syracuse and Ortigia

  • Taormina
  • Syracuse
  • More
  • Cathedral of Syracuse
  • Fountain of Diana
  • Island of Ortigia
  • More

After a delicious breakfast, journey to Syracuse and check into your hotel. Spend the afternoon exploring Ortigia, the historic heart of Syracuse. Begin at Piazza del Duomo and admire the Syracuse Cathedral. Wander through the picturesque streets, visit the Fountain of Arethusa, and enjoy the sea views along the waterfront promenade. Conclude your day at the Temple of Apollo and savor Sicilian delicacies at the local markets. Overnight in Syracuse.

Day6

Day 6
Day 6: Discover Noto's Baroque Beauty

  • Syracuse
  • Noto
  • More
  • Playa Ognina
  • Netum
  • Porta Reale o Ferdinandea
  • More

After breakfast, travel to Noto, a city celebrated for its stunning Baroque architecture. Begin your exploration at the Noto Cathedral and admire its grand façade. Visit Palazzo Ducezio and the ornate Hall of Mirrors. Stroll through the elegant streets, stopping at Porta Reale and savoring local almond pastries. Enjoy a leisurely evening in this historic gem. Overnight in Noto.

Day7

Day 7
Day 7: Baroque Wonders of Ragusa and Modica

  • Ragusa
  • Modica
  • Noto
  • More
  • Duomo di San Giorgio
  • Giardino Ibleo
  • Netum
  • More

After breakfast, drive to Ragusa, a city renowned for its Baroque architecture. Explore Ragusa Ibla, the historic heart, and visit the Duomo di San Giorgio. In the afternoon, head to Modica, famous for its chocolate-making tradition. Discover the town's scenic viewpoints and indulge in its unique chocolate. Return to Noto for an overnight stay.

Day8

Day 8
Day 8: Ancient Wonders of Agrigento

  • Agrigento
  • Noto
  • More
  • Tempio Di Zeus Olympios
  • Temple of Dioscuri (Temple I)
  • More

After breakfast, journey to Agrigento and explore the Valley of the Temples,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Begin at the Temple of Juno and follow the paths to the Temple of Concordia, one of the best-preserved Greek temples. Immerse yourself in the ancient history and enjoy the breathtaking views. Overnight in Agrigento.

Day9

Day 9
Day 9: Coastal Beauty and Historic Towns

  • Agrigento
  • More
  • Saline di Trapani
  • Scala dei Turchi
  • Donnafugata
  • Piazza Madrice
  • More

After breakfast, explore the stunning Scala dei Turchi, a white limestone cliff rising from the Mediterranean. Alternatively, visit Marsala for its historic center and renowned wine, or head to Trapani to explore its picturesque old town. For a unique experience, venture to Erice, a medieval hilltop town with spectacular views. Overnight in Agrigento.
